Context & Ripple Effects
World Labs’ spatial-AI arc began with a 2024 preview that turned an image into a game-like 3D scene, then broadened with Marble’s editable 3D environments from prompts, photos and other media in 2025. Atlas extends that work from scene generation into controlled image/video views and 3D reconstruction.
The company’s $1 billion financing was explicitly aimed at world models for robotics and scientific discovery, while Tencent had already released an open-weights model for 3D-consistent video from a single image. The competitive question is increasingly whether a model can preserve usable spatial structure, not merely produce plausible footage.
First-order effects
- World Labs broadens its offering beyond Marble’s editable environments to a model that combines view-controlled image and video generation with 3D reconstruction.
- Public Atlas demonstrations describe turning footage from a few phone cameras into new camera angles and generating portions of a scene that were not filmed, giving creators a spatially aware post-production workflow.
Second-order effects
- Tencent’s HunyuanWorld-Voyager and other world-model developers face a sharper benchmark: 3D-consistent output alone is less differentiating when camera control and reconstruction are presented as one system.
- Atlas gives World Labs a concrete capability set to pursue the robotics and scientific-discovery applications cited in its funding round, without establishing any confirmed integration with Autodesk products.
Third-order effects
- World models are developing into a shared spatial layer for synthetic media and physical-AI simulation, where controllable viewpoints and recoverable geometry matter alongside visual quality.
- If model builders continue combining generation with reconstruction, competition will shift from producing individual clips toward controlling reusable, navigable representations of scenes.
The trend: Generative AI is moving from making isolated images and videos toward world models that maintain and manipulate a scene’s spatial structure.
